Introduction to Diseases
Diseases are abnormal conditions that negatively affect the structure or function of the
body or mind. They can be caused by infections, genetic factors, environmental
influences, lifestyle choices, or a combination thereof. Recognizing the diversity of
diseases helps in better diagnosis and management.
Types of Diseases
Diseases can be broadly categorized into several types based on their causes, duration,
and effects.
1. Infectious Diseases
Infectious diseases are caused by pathogenic microorganisms such as bacteria, viruses,
fungi, or parasites. They can be transmitted from person to person or through vectors.
Examples: Influenza, HIV/AIDS, Tuberculosis, Malaria, COVID-19
Transmission methods: Airborne, contact, vector-borne, contaminated food/water
2. Genetic Diseases
Genetic diseases result from abnormalities in an individual's DNA, inherited from parents
or caused by mutations.
Examples: Cystic fibrosis, Sickle cell anemia, Hemophilia, Huntington's disease
Inheritance patterns: Autosomal dominant, autosomal recessive, X-linked
3. Chronic Diseases
Chronic diseases are long-lasting conditions that often progress slowly and require
ongoing management.
2
Examples: Diabetes mellitus, Hypertension, Chronic obstructive pulmonary disease
(COPD), Arthritis
Risk factors: Lifestyle, environment, genetics
4. Degenerative Diseases
Degenerative diseases involve progressive deterioration of tissues or organs.
Examples: Alzheimer’s disease, Parkinson’s disease, Osteoarthritis
5. Autoimmune Diseases
Autoimmune disorders occur when the immune system attacks the body's own cells.
Examples: Rheumatoid arthritis, Multiple sclerosis, Lupus erythematosus

Prominent Examples of Professional Disease Guides
Several authoritative resources serve as exemplary professional guides:
1. Harrison's Principles of Internal Medicine
- Widely regarded as the gold standard in internal medicine. - Features detailed chapters
on infectious diseases, cardiology, neurology, and more. - Pros: - Comprehensive and
authoritative. - Regularly updated. - Cons: - Dense and lengthy, potentially overwhelming
for quick reference.
2. The Merck Manual
- Accessible online and in print, suitable for clinicians and students. - Pros: - Concise
summaries. - User-friendly interface. - Cons: - Less detailed than specialized texts.
3. UpToDate
- An evidence-based, peer-reviewed clinical decision support resource. - Features
interactive algorithms and recent research updates. - Pros: - Highly current. - Practical for
bedside decision-making. - Cons: - Subscription-based, which may limit access. ---
